A Post-War Birth: Miss Dior Cologne and Perfume (1947)

The year was 1947. Post-war Paris was slowly rebuilding, its spirit bruised but not broken. Christian Dior, having just launched his revolutionary "New Look" collection that redefined women's fashion, unveiled another masterpiece: Miss Dior. This wasn't just a perfume; it was a statement. Named in tribute to his beloved sister, Catherine Dior, a member of the French Resistance known affectionately as "Miss Dior," the fragrance embodied both resilience and femininity.

Created by the perfumers Paul Vacher and Jean Carles, the original Miss Dior was a groundbreaking floral chypre. This olfactory family, characterized by its blend of floral, mossy, and woody notes, was revolutionary for its time. The top notes, a vibrant burst of mandarin, gardenia, and bergamot, created an initial impression of bright, sunny optimism. The heart, a rich tapestry of jasmine, narcissus, neroli, and rose, revealed a more sensual and complex character. This floral heart was further enriched by the addition of other floral notes, creating a bouquet that was both sophisticated and undeniably feminine. The base notes, however, provided a surprising twist. The inclusion of leather and galbanum, a resin with a distinctly green and slightly sharp aroma, added a grounding earthiness and a touch of unexpected rebellion, mirroring the spirit of Catherine Dior herself. This unexpected contrast, the delicate floral heart juxtaposed against the assertive leather and galbanum, became a defining characteristic of Miss Dior's unique identity. This original formulation, available as both a cologne and a perfume, laid the foundation for the fragrance's enduring legacy.
